TOPICS DISCUSSED IN THIS PODCAST EPISODE:Jason Donald was born in Scotland and grew up in South Africa. He studied English Literature and Philosophy at St. Andrews University and is a graduate of the Glasgow University Creative Writing MA. His debut novel, Choke Chain, published by Jonathan Cape, was shortlisted for the Authors' Club Best First Novel Award and the Saltire First Book Award.
His second novel, Dalila, was published by Jonathan Cape/Vintage in January 2017.
He has also published short stories in various literary journals, including The Astronaut for BBC Radio 4 and Puerta Galera for the Edinburgh International Book Festival.
Donald has just written and co-directed his first short film, Passion Gap.
He lives with his wife in Switzerland.
